National Workshop For Handmade Paper

The National Workshop for Handmade Paper is one of the seventh in the World in which the paper is made in the original Chinese way from Second Century BC. The method is unique and it revives the old tradition in Ohrid. Don't miss the unique opportunity to be presented this way of making the paper and imprint your memories from Ohrid on Gutenberg's press from XVth century.

Holy Mary Perybleptos

Reviewed By IgorMarkovic - Smederevo, Serbia

The Holy Mary Perybleptos church is considered to be one of the most important religious, historical, archeological, but also site with artistic value. The church is the oldest one in the city and is considered to be one of the preserved ones, not only in Macedonia, but also in the region. It is most famous for its mesmerizing and truly amazing fresoces, with unusual depictions of the scenes described in the Bible. If you're a history buff, then the richness of frescoes and the history of the church itself will for sure amaze you and inspire to explore more about the church and the amazing city of Ohrid. Original Ohrid Pearls

Ohrid the city of lights, the pearl on the balcans is well known and recognised by the true essebce and beauty of the one of a kind rear treasure of the family pearls of Dr. Pavel Filev. The pearl store is located near the city centre st. Car Samoil no.10. It is a decoration of the town. The color, shimmer and radiance of the Ohrid pearls are taken from the nature including the natural beauty of the scales of the endemic fish Plashica. The process is a well kept family tradition passed on from generation to generation. The family tradition of this wonderful fairytale come to life, today Dr. Pavel Filev is sharing with the fourth generation, his daughter Marija and son Dimitrija. To add to this wonder is the outstanding precision of the master hands by Dr. Pavel Filev who is the only craftman in Ohrid that works and makes filigree, transfering it slowly and preacously to his children Marija and Dimitrija.
